There are 2 general models to consider when discussing treatment of offenders. First is the medical model, which focuses on psychological evaluation and creating a treatment plan that corresponds with the evaluation.

The second model is known as the psycho/social/behavioral model. This model uses several methods, including a risk assessment and a thorough treatment prescription process. The psycho/social/behavioral model looks at all aspects of the offender’s life.

As required by law, every health care facility must maintain a medical record for each patient that it treats (Pozgar, 2004). Although the exact specifications may vary slightly across each state, there are still some basic legal principles to remember when dealing with the medical record. Athens Administrators is an open indemnity claims administration services organization. Athens identified a growing trend of future medical claims within their client’s population. The trend had begun to escalate and Athens decided that it was an important issue to bring to the clients attention and to jointly develop a strategy to address the growth of these claims. Athens looked to modify and improve the processes and procedures that were being utilized to address these claims.
